Teaching & Academic Mentorship
As an experimental condensed matter physicist, my teaching philosophy emphasizes conceptual clarity, analytical rigor, and research-oriented learning. I aim to bridge foundational physics with modern developments in materials science, encouraging students to connect theory with experimental practice.
I actively mentor undergraduate and postgraduate students, guiding them toward independent research thinking and scientific problem-solving.

Teaching Philosophy
I believe effective teaching in physics requires:
Building strong mathematical intuition
Connecting microscopic mechanisms to measurable properties
Encouraging curiosity-driven questioning
Integrating classroom learning with laboratory exposure
My goal is to cultivate students who are capable of independent research, interdisciplinary collaboration, and critical scientific thinking.
